Task Forces are groups of individuals tasked with achieving a particular outcome, tackling a particular problem, over a specific period of time. In the context of APAN, Task Forces are expected to support outcomes in the interests of APAN members and the communities that they support. Some Task Forces may support planning for a particular Working Group, or support the development of a major demonstration/event, while others may tackle more strategic issues for APAN as a whole. Participation is open to any interested parties who can bring expertise, enthusiasm, resources or other benefits to the Task Force. Please read the draft Task Forces Overview for more details.

Proposals for Task Forces can come from any interested party, and are submitted to APAN Secretariat (sec AT apan.net) for processing. A proposal for a Task Force must provide the following information:

  • A topic/title
  • A brief description, including the scope of activities (or terms of reference)
  • A set of defined, measurable outcomes, including delivery dates
  • A proposed chair
  • A list of the initial participants and who else may be interested/involved.
  • What, if any, support the Task Force may require from APAN or any members

Budget & Fees Task Force

Chair : Shinji Shimojo

Background

The APAN Council of Primary Members established this taskforce to review the budget and fees structure for APAN

Objective

To support the GM, and Board in forming a neutral committee consisting of primary members to collectively propose a fees structure

Goals

The goals of the Task Force are currently to:

  • Assess the operation cost based on budget and cost
  • Assist the GM to develop the fees model
  • Propose the new structure to the Board and Council

 

Updates :

  1. Budget for 2024 and 2025 was approved.
  2. New Membership fees for the term 2025-2027 was approved at APAN57, Bangkok during an EGM
